What is the FOX TV App?
The FOX TV app is a streaming application that provides access to a wide range of content from the FOX network. Think of it as your personal portal to all things FOX, right at your fingertips. You can watch full episodes of current TV shows, stream live TV (in select markets), and access a vast library of on-demand content. The app is available on various platforms, including iOS and Android devices, Roku, Apple TV, Fire TV, and more, ensuring you can enjoy your favorite shows on your preferred device.
The FOX TV app primarily features content from the FOX broadcast network. This includes popular dramas like "9-1-1" and "The Cleaning Lady", comedies such as "Animal Control" and animated hits like "The Simpsons", "Family Guy", and "Bob's Burgers". In addition to these, the app also provides access to live sports events, including NFL games, MLB games, and college football, depending on your location and subscription. Reality TV fans will appreciate the availability of shows like "The Masked Singer" and "Next Level Chef", making the FOX TV app a comprehensive entertainment hub. The app also includes local FOX station programming, such as news and weather, which further enhances its utility for users who want to stay connected to their local communities.

How to Download and Install the FOX TV App
Downloading and installing the FOX TV app is a breeze. Here's a quick guide:
- For iOS Devices (iPhone, iPad):
- Open the App Store on your device.
- Search for "FOX NOW" (it may have been renamed).
- Tap "Get" to download the app.
- Once downloaded, tap "Open" to launch the app.
- For Android Devices:
- Open the Google Play Store on your device.
- Search for "FOX NOW".
- Tap "Install" to download the app.
- Once downloaded, tap "Open" to launch the app.
- For Roku:
- Press the "Home" button on your Roku remote.
- Select "Streaming Channels" to open the Channel Store.
- Search for "FOX NOW".
- Select the app and click "Add channel".
- For Apple TV:
- Open the App Store on your Apple TV.
- Search for "FOX NOW".
- Select the app and click "Get" to download.
- For Fire TV:
- From the Fire TV home screen, select "Find".
- Select "Search".
- Search for "FOX NOW".
- Select the app and click "Get" to download.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
Like any app, the FOX TV app can sometimes encounter issues. Here are some common problems and how to fix them:
- App Not Working:
- Make sure you have a stable internet connection.
- Try closing and reopening the app.
- Restart your device.
- Check for app updates in the App Store or Google Play Store.
- Clear the app's cache and data (Android only).
- Uninstall and reinstall the app.
- Live TV Not Working:
- Ensure live TV is available in your area.
- Check your TV provider credentials are correct.
- Make sure your TV provider subscription includes access to live streaming.
- Video Playback Issues:
- Try lowering the video quality in the app settings.
- Close other apps that may be using bandwidth.
- Check your internet speed.
